Umm from my understanding
91 sr20s have no abs or hicas options ?
92+ it was an option to have (ive seen some 92s without abs)
95+ got the black rocker cover motors
97+ type-x... different interior trim, updated exterior panels..

not sure if any come with airbags tho ?

all will have power steering and mirrors and windows etc tho

One thing that alot of people miss is that 1990 180sx were available with sr20det's. I have rps13000478 (pretty low chasis no eh) and it a 1990 model. Many people/sites state the change over year as 91.
